Obituary
Diane Singleton
October 19th, 1943 - July 29th, 2023
Diane Zada Singleton, 79, of Idaho Falls, passed away July 29, 2023, at Idaho Falls Community Hospital, due to poor health and complications after surgery. Diane passed away with her adoring husband of 57 years and many other loving family members by her side.
Diane was born October 19, 1943, in Idaho Falls, Idaho, as the third child of LaSell Hyrum Crook and Beulah Kearney Crook. She attended elementary school and O.E. Bell Junior High in Idaho Falls. She later graduated from Idaho Falls High School in 1962, where she learned how to play the clarinet. Following high school, she attended cosmetology school and after, owned her own beauty shop and worked as a successful hairdresser for over 50 years.
On October 13, 1966, she married Larry Singleton in Idaho Falls. They were later sealed for all time and eternity in the Idaho Falls Temple on June 25, 1992. Diane and Larry met in church during junior high and later became high school sweethearts. They spent their whole married lives in Idaho Falls, where they created a beautiful family.
Diane was a member of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. She served in many callings, including Relief Society President and Young Women’s President. She had a strong love for the church and enjoyed going to girl’s camp with the young women. As an accomplished hairdresser, she received several cosmetology awards and served as the former president of the Idaho Falls Cosmetology Association. She organized and participated in many hair shows, and won several awards for her hard work and talent.
Diane had many hobbies, including reading, doing puzzles, playing games, collecting rocks, going camping with her family and reminiscing on her most cherished memories. The most important thing in the world to her was her family and spending time with her grandkids.
Diane is survived by her loving husband Larry Singleton of Idaho Falls, ID; son, Bret Larry Singleton of Lakeland, FL; daughter, Wendee Diane (Kody) Christensen of Idaho Falls, ID; 9 grandchildren, Colby, Austen, Westen, Kortnee, Kynlee, Keaten, Kelcee, Kenny, and Kamree; and 3 great grandchildren, Brynley, Berkley and Erik. She was preceded in death by her parents, brother, John Crook, sister, Beverly Crook Rhees, and grandson, Jake Douglas.
